COVER LETTER: BJ045 SUMMARY: This project needs about 40 hours times 28 baselines to meet the sensitivity requirements. This time can be accumulated in many separated sessions but MK should appear in all sessions. Each session should be a full track with all antennas to set the calibration and ensure full uv coverage. Tropospheric weather is the problem for these 3mm observations. 3C274 is mostly a night-time object now. 2 tapes per station. -------------------------------------------------------------------- Here is the official dynamic scheduling sheet: ================================================================ Preferred Dynamic Contraints. The solar corona can cause unstable phases for sources too close to the Sun. SCHED provides warnings at individual scans for distances less than 10 degrees. The distance from the Sun to each source in this schedule is: Source Sun distance (deg) 3C273 110.9 3C274 114.0 Barry Clark estimates from predictions by Ketan Desai of IPM scattering sizes that the Sun will cause amplitude reductions on the longest VLBA baselines at a solar distance of 60deg F^(-0.6) where F is in GHz.
